Merger update

Note: Uttar Bihar Gramin Bank (UBGB) and Dakshin Bihar Gramin Bank (DBGB) have been merged and now operate under Punjab National Bank (PNB) for electronic clearing. The merged rural bank branches use the single IFSC code PUNB0MBGB06. Old UBGB IFSC codes have been revoked. For any NEFT/RTGS/IMPS transfer to these branches, use only the new IFSC PUNB0MBGB06. Transfers initiated with revoked/old IFSCs can be delayed or returned.

What is an IFSC code?

The Indian Financial System Code (IFSC) is an 11-character alphanumeric code used to identify bank branches in electronic payment systems. Its structure is fixed:

  • First 4 characters — bank code. Example: PUNB = Punjab National Bank.
  • 5th character — reserved and is always 0.
  • Last 6 characters — branch identifier. In PUNB0MBGB06, the last six characters are MBGB06 which point to the specific branch code.

Q: Is IFSC the same as MICR?
A: No. IFSC is used for electronic transfers. MICR (Magnetic Ink Character Recognition) is used mainly for cheque processing and appears on the cheque leaf. This branch’s MICR is 800811002.
